Veneto, a picturesque region in northeastern Italy, boasts a rich history that intertwines with its vinicultural legacy. The area, enveloped by the majestic Alps to the north and the serene Adriatic Sea to the east, enjoys a unique terroir that fosters the growth of a variety of premium grape vines. Over the centuries, Veneto has etched its name in the annals of wine lore, producing wines that resonate with character and passion. From the gentle slopes of Verona to the flat plains of Treviso, each vineyard carries with it a story, a tradition, and a promise of quality. The region's climate varies from continental to maritime, giving rise to wines that exhibit a diverse array of flavors and aromas. Veneto is a captivating region located in the northeastern part of Italy. Stretching from the southern shores of Lake Garda to the enchanting canals of Venice, and further east to the Dolomites' majestic peaks, Veneto encompasses a vast and diverse geographical expanse. Its proximity to major water bodies, especially the Adriatic Sea, combined with the Alpine influences, gives Veneto a unique climatic blend that's immensely beneficial for viticulture. Historically, the region has been a nexus of art, commerce, and culture, with cities like Verona, Padua, and Venice serving as significant centers during the Renaissance era. This rich history is intertwined with its viticultural legacy, making Veneto not just a geographical region but a journey into Italy's wine heartland.

What type of wine is X most known for?

Veneto is renowned for a plethora of wines, but if one were to pick a flagship, it would be Prosecco. Originating from the sub-region of Valdobbiadene, this sparkling wine has garnered global acclaim for its vivacious bubbles and fruity profile. However, Veneto is not just about Prosecco. The region is also celebrated for its Amarone della Valpolicella, a rich and intense red wine made using a unique drying process called "appassimento." Furthermore, wines like Soave, Bardolino, and Valpolicella Classico further establish Veneto's reputation as a diversified wine-producing region.

What are the best wines from X?

Determining the "best" wines from Veneto can be subjective, given the vast range of wines the region produces. However, some standout wines that have consistently received accolades include the Amarone della Valpolicella, which offers deep flavors of dried fruits, tobacco, and chocolate. Prosecco from Valdobbiadene, especially the Superiore DOCG, is another sparkling gem that wine enthusiasts treasure. The elegant and crisp Soave Classico, with its almond and citrus notes, is another highlight. Additionally, the Corvina-based wines of Valpolicella, such as the Ripasso and Recioto, have their dedicated fan base, given their complex profiles and aging potential. Each of these wines encapsulates the essence of Veneto, celebrating its rich heritage and innovative spirit.
